Spanning approximately 3,500 sq ft, this exquisite converted Victorian schoolhouse delivers an exceptional standard of luxury, blending superb entertaining spaces with practical open-plan living. With excellent volume and an abundance of natural light throughout, the residence is crafted for both grand hosting and refined family life. Off street parking for two cars and a spacious private roof terrace provide exclusive outdoor space. The top floor principal bedroom is a show stopper: loft style ceilings, two separate en suite bathrooms, plus its own private terrace an oasis of tranquillity.
On the ground floor, you are welcomed by a large, bright reception room complete with a striking fireplace, stunning oak floors, and generous entertaining capacity. To the rear lies an open plan kitchen finished to an exceptional standard, featuring premium Gaggenau appliances.
The lower ground floor adds even more versatility: there’s another reception room, a utility room, guest cloakroom, and a cinema room perfect for family evenings or entertaining friends. The first floor comprises three spacious double bedrooms with fitted wardrobes; two benefit from ensuite bathrooms, while a large family bathroom serves the third. Large windows flood each room with light. On the second floor, discover an area that rivals the finest hotel suites: a grand principal bedroom with built in fireplace and cosy seating area, two expansive bathrooms, and a fifth bedroom ideal for a large home office.
A floating internal staircase leads to the third floor, where a glass walkway connects two large dressing rooms. From the rear dressing room, you step out onto a secluded terrace offering extensive views.
Location
Old Garden House is located on Bridge Lane, a quiet road
south of Battersea Village Square, and within a ten minute drive from Chelsea, at approx. 1.4 miles away. This area is host to a diverse mix of shops and restaurants, and the house is very near to the open greenspaces of Battersea Park. The architecturally renowned Battersea Power Station development is 1.3miles away and has an excellent array of restaurants, bars, restaurants, shops, entertainment and leisure venues.
There are excellent transport links, from Clapham Junction approx 0.9 miles away, Battersea Park Station approx 1.0 miles away and Queenstown Road Station approx 1.1 miles away.
